A subcable test facility was prepared to study ac losses and stability of subsize cables under the pulsing magnetic field of a 40-kJ split-pair coil. A G-10 cryostat fabricated for the system has an inner diameter of 31 cm and is 170 cm deep. An 80-kW power supply for the coil has a pulsing mode of triangular operation. Another 500-kW power supply, rated for dc operation at 400 V and 1250 A, can have pulsing modes of triangular, trapezoidal, or (B + B) superimposed. AC losses of a superconducting composite strand with CuNi outer sheath were measured. Coupling losses among the strands were not significant because of the outer sheath.
